[QUOTE="Ocatarinetabellatchitchix, post: 3790282, member: 99554"]Constantius I, also named Constantius Chlorus or Constantius the Pale is my latest acquisition. Why the nickname « the Pale » ? Just because of the alleged paleness of his face. He was maybe the grandnephew of Claudius the Gothicus, but it is not a certainty. He was adopted and declared Caesar in 292 by Maximian Hercules. On the first May of 305 AD he was recognized with Galerius Maximianus as [I]Augusti[/I], and reign as co-emperors with Maximinus Daza and Fl.Severus. Constantius was married twice ; his first wife was a [I]Saint[/I] ! (Helena) and his second one was Theodora ( daughter of Maximian Hercules). He had 6 children with Theodora and only one with Helena, Constantine (he was a [I]Great[/I] son...). The urban legend says that he was a Christian ; but the only facts we have is that he showed not only tolerance, but a genuine sympathy towards the persecuted members of that religion. Convinced of their fidelity, he offered them an asylum in his own palace. In 305-306 AD he fought against the Picts in Britain, and during the summer he felt sick.
